    I think those are plays that the Steelers got caught in the wrong scheme, not designed with the idea that Timmons will be covering a receiver or tight end 30 yards down field. That is the price of all the blitzing.

    That said, Timmons has made a few big plays in coverage, including a huge interception against the Giants. Is he better rushing the passer than covering? Absolutely, but the same is true of every linebacker they have except possibly Shazier.

    I think they may move on from Timmons after this season unless Harrison retires. I'm guessing one of them will be gone.I wonder if they would move Timmons outside and start Williams. Remember, that is where he began his career.

    A small thing from the victory over the Dolphins that I haven't seen mentioned elsewhere. For all the talk of Harrison's play, it was something that doesn't show up in any statistics that helped make a difference. On the fumble forced by Mike Mitchell, Harrison hit Jay Ajayi and kept the running back from grabbing Moore's fumble, giving Walton the opportunity to recover it.
